Introduction of the Driving Exam in Poland

The Polish driving exam includes two main parts: the theoretical and the practical. Each segment has particular requirements and testing processes that applicants should stick to.

Table 1: Summary of the Driving Exam Components

Exam ComponentTypeDescription
Theoretical ExamWrittenConsists of multiple-choice concerns on traffic laws, road signs, and safe driving practices.
Practical ExamDriving TestIncludes demonstrating driving skills in real-time, concentrating on maneuverability and adherence to traffic regulations.

Eligibility Requirements

To take the driving exam in Poland, prospects need to satisfy specific eligibility criteria. Here's a checklist of the requirements:

List of Eligibility Requirements

  1. Minimum Age: Applicants must be at least 18 years of ages for a classification B license (guest cars).
  2. Medical checkup: A medical certificate verifying physical fitness to drive need to be obtained from a certified doctor.
  3. Driving Course Completion: Completion of a recognized driving course, typically including theoretical and practical lessons.
  4. Identity Verification: Valid identification (such as a passport or ID card) need to be provided throughout registration.
  5. Permit Application: Candidates must make an application for and obtain a learner's permit before taking the exams.

The Theoretical Exam

The theoretical driving exam in Poland is designed to examine the prospect's knowledge of traffic rules, road signs, and safe driving practices.

Structure of the Theoretical Exam

The theoretical exam typically consists of:

  • Multiple-choice Questions: Approximately 32 questions will exist, covering different subjects.
  • Passing Score: A score of a minimum of 68% (24 appropriate answers) is required to pass.
  • Period: Candidates generally have 50 minutes to finish the exam.

The Practical Exam

Following the effective conclusion of the theoretical exam, candidates may arrange the practical driving test. This element assesses the candidate's capability to manage an automobile and follow traffic regulations.

Structure of the Practical Exam

  • Car Inspection: Before the test begins, the inspector will assess the condition of the automobile.
  • Driving Maneuvers: The prospect will carry out various tasks, such as parking, lane changes, and following traffic signals.
  • Duration: The useful exam can last anywhere from 30 to 40 minutes.

Often Asked Questions (FAQs)

1. What is the cost of the driving exam in Poland?

The cost varies depending upon the driving school and area, however on average, candidates can anticipate to pay between 2,000 to 4,000 PLN for the whole process, including lessons and exam fees.

2. How long does it require to get the results of the exams?

Outcomes for the theoretical exam are generally offered right away, while useful exam results can take a week or longer to be processed.

3. What takes place if I fail the exam?

Prospects who stop working the theoretical or useful exam can retake it. The waiting duration might differ, with a typical recommendation to set up a retake after practicing the areas they had problem with.

4. Can I take the driving exam in English?

Yes, some testing focuses offer exams in English and other languages. It is essential to specify this demand at the time of registration.

5. Are there any additional requirements for foreign applicants?

Foreigners must supply a translation of their identity documents and may need to meet particular regulations, depending upon their native land. It is recommended to contact local authorities for in-depth information.
